Shrink sleeve packaging is a dynamic and growing market, valued for its 360-degree design capability, tamper-evident properties, and versatility across substrates. However, its inherent technical complexity has long been a barrier to efficient, cost-effective production.

⚠ Repacking fails if the new container’s shrink profile differs significantly (e.g., severe taper, deep flutes, irregular shoulders). Always verify shrink limits first.
